Deploying Renewables in Southeast Asian Countries
Deploying Renewables in Southeast Asian Countries This paper is part of the IEA ongoing analysis of global renewable energy markets and policies. It focuses on six Southeast Asian countries: Indonesia, Malaysia, the Philippines, Singapore, Thailand, and Viet Nam. The report investigates the potentials and barriers for scaling up market penetration of renewable energy technologies in the electricity, heating and transport sectors in the six countries.

Status of Power System Transformation 2018: Summary for Policy Makers
…they call for increased flexibility of power systems. Power system flexibility encompasses all relevant characteristics of a power system that facilitates the reliable and cost-effective management of variability and uncertainty in both supply and demand. A lack of system flexibility can reduce the resilience of power systems, or lead to the loss of substantial amounts of clean electricity through curtailment of variable renewable energy sources. Power plants play a critical role in enhancing system flexibility. Based on a wealth of real-life case studies and data, this report provides a comprehensive overview of how power plants can contribute to…

Thailand’s Clean Electricity Transition
How accelerated deployment of renewables can help achieve Thailand’s climate targets Since the publication of its latest Power Development Plan (PDP) in 2020 (PDP 2018 Revision 1), Thailand has considerably increased its emissions reductions objectives, announcing a net zero greenhouse gas emissions target for 2065 and carbon neutrality for 2050. As the power sector is a large part of the country’s emissions, and because it has a key role to play in decarbonising other sectors, meeting these targets is possible only if the power sector is decarbonising too. This report hence analyses how Thailand can achieve its clean electricity…

Partner Country Series - Thailand Renewable Grid Integration Assessment
Thailand’s power sector policy focuses on reducing dependence on natural gas to enhance energy security. With the dramatic reduction in the costs of variable renewable energy (VRE) – solar PV and wind power – Thailand is beginning to experience the transformation of its power sector. Conventional power generation is beginning to give way to new alternative sources and generation is moving from centralised to distributed forms. Thailand has the highest share of VRE in the Association of Southeast Asian Nations (ASEAN) region. Given the unique characteristics of VRE, which are variable and partly unpredictable, there are concerns over the potential operational…
